  • Density of Hematite (iron ore) in 285 units of density

    Hematite (iron ore) weighs 5.15 gram per cubic centimeter or 5 150 kilogram per cubic meter, i.e. density of hematite (iron ore) is equal to 5 150 kg/m³. In Imperial or US customary measurement system, the density is equal to 321.504 pound per cubic foot [lb/ft³], or 2.977 ounce per cubic inch [oz/inch³] .

  • Enhanced photocurrent density of hematite thin films

    The hematite film on the surface of the FTO substrate annealed at 700 °C showed an enhanced photocurrent value with a maximum photocurrent of 0.39 mA cm −2 at 1.23 V vs. RHE under 1 sun illumination. This is a much enhanced photocurrent value of the hematite films than that of those annealed at temperatures lower than 700 °C.

  • Prediction of density and volume variation of

    2019-4-13  The results show that the density of the ore particles decreases by 15.1% at most along the progressive reduction process. Furthermore, the model results also indicate that heating, melting and reduction of the ore could lead to 6.63–9.37% swelling of the particles, which is mostly contributed by thermal expansion.

  • The Density of Common Rocks and Minerals -

    2020-1-23  The densities of rocks and minerals are normally expressed as specific gravity, which is the density of the rock relative to the density of water. This isn't as complex as you may think because water's density is 1 gram per cubic centimeter or 1 g/cm 3. Therefore, these numbers translate directly to g/cm 3, or tonnes per cubic meter (t/m 3).

  • Enhanced Photoelectrochemical Performance of

    2021-2-25  The photocurrent density of hematite is 0.44 mA/cm 2. After doping Ti and Zr, each Ti and Zr atom donates an electron to Fe, which improves the electrical conductivity of the photoanode. According to the previous literature [29, 35, 39], this increase in electrical conductivity can also improve the surface oxidation kinetics.
